KELLY College U13s opened their cricket season with a 20 run victory over Wellington School. It was a low scoring match played on a damp ground following recent torrential rain.

Tight bowling by Wellington reduced Kelly to 16-2 before Callum Worth anchored the innings and Tristan Smith, Torban May and Jo Routly began to swing the bat as Kelly ended on 69.

In reply, Wellington started briskly but accurate bowling supported by sharp fielding from Ben Staig, Ben Dunlop, Ted Jenks and wicket-keeper Jack Morris put a check on their progress. Ben Grove with five wickets and Callum Worth with four helped reduce Wellington to 49 runs. 

n Both the Mount House Colts' Cricket teams opened the season with home matches against Exeter Cathedral School, winning one and losing the other. The Mount House A team scored 114 for 7 in 20 overs including a 47 not out by Jack Smyly. Bowlers Jonty Walliker and Hunter Strand bowled well to reduce Exeter to 26 all out

The Colts B match was played in pairs format, and batting first Exeter posted a very impressive total of 328 in their 20 overs while in reply Mount House scored 249.
